Track 01
Advancements in Wearable Sensors for Sports Performance

This track explores the latest innovations in wearable sensor technology and their applications in monitoring athletic performance. Researchers will present findings on how these sensors can enhance data collection and analysis in sports science.

Track 02
Data Analytics in Fitness Tracking: Trends and Techniques

This session focuses on the role of data analytics in fitness tracking, highlighting methodologies that improve the interpretation of health metrics. Participants will discuss the implications of big data in optimizing training regimens for athletes.

Track 03
AI and Machine Learning in Exercise Science

This track examines the integ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ning in exercise science research. Presenters will showcase how these technologies can predict performance outcomes and personalize training programs.

Track 04
Monitoring Athlete Health: Innovations and Challenges

This session addresses the latest innovations in monitoring athlete health through wearable technology. Discussions will include the challenges faced in ensuring data accuracy and athlete privacy.

Track 05
Physiological Responses to Wearable Fitness Technologies

This track investigates the physiological responses of athletes to various wearable fitness technologies. Researchers will present studies on how these devices influence training effectiveness and recovery.

Track 06
Enhancing Endurance Training with Wearable Tech

This session focuses on the application of wearable technology in enhancing endurance training for athletes. Presentations will cover the impact of real-time feedback on performance and training adaptations.

Track 07
Strength Training Innovations through Fitness Tracking

This track explores the intersection of strength training and fitness tracking innovations. Experts will discuss how wearable devices can optimize strength training protocols and monitor progress effectively.

Track 08
Recovery Strategies: The Role of Wearable Technology

This session highlights the importance of recovery strategies in sports science and the role of wearable technology in facilitating these processes. Participants will explore how data from wearables can inform recovery practices for athletes.

Track 09
The Future of Fitness Tracking: Trends and Predictions

This track delves into emerging trends and future predictions in the field of fitness tracking technologies. Experts will discuss potential advancements and their implications for sports science and athlete performance.

Track 10
Ethical Considerations in Wearable Technology Research

This session addresses the ethical considerations surrounding the use of wearable technology in sports science research. Discussions will focus on data privacy, consent, and the responsibilities of researchers and developers.

Track 11
Integrating Wearable Technology into Coaching Practices

This track examines how coaches can effectively integrate wearable technology into their training practices. Presenters will share insights on enhancing athlete engagement and performance through data-driven coaching strategies.
